COMPACT MEMBRANE MODULE SYSTEM FOR GAS SEPARATION
20190143263 · 2019-05-16 ·

A device for separating a gas, such as air, into components, includes a plurality of modules, each module having one or more polymeric membranes capable of gas separation. A set of valves, pipes, and manifolds together arrange the modules in one of two possible configurations. In a first configuration, the modules are arranged in parallel. In a second configuration, the modules are divided into two groups which are arranged in series. The device can be switched from parallel to series, or from series to parallel, simply by changing the positions of a small number of valves, typically three valves. The device can therefore produce gas either of higher purity, or moderate purity, depending on the settings of the valves.

Manifolds for Use in Conducting Dialysis
20190134566 · 2019-05-09 ·

The present application discloses novel systems for conducting the filtration of blood using manifolds. The manifolds integrate various sensors and have fluid pathways formed therein to direct fluids from various sources through the requisite blood filtration or ultrafiltration system steps.

Manifold diaphragms

The specification discloses a portable dialysis machine having a detachable controller unit and base unit. The controller unit includes a door having an interior face, a housing with a panel, where the housing and panel define a recessed region configured to receive the interior face of the door, and a manifold receiver fixedly attached to the panel. The manifold includes diaphragms adapted to minimize the dead space between the dialysis machine pins and improve responsivity. The base unit has a planar surface for receiving a container of fluid, a scale integrated with the planar surface and a heater in thermal communication with the container. Embodiments of the disclosed portable dialysis system have improved structural and functional features, including improved modularity, ease of use, and safety features.

Compact pulmonary assist device for destination therapy
10251989 · 2019-04-09 · ·

The present invention relates generally to a pulmonary assist device comprising a housing having tapered inlets and outlets to distribute blood evenly over a fiber bundle. The fiber bundle has a relatively low packing density to prevent the formation of clots. The invention is adapted to be used with a pump or without a pump, in which the heart supplies the necessary blood flow. Moreover, the device can be used as a single module or as multiple modules arranged in parallel.

Single Pass Tangential Flow Filtration Systems And Tangential Flow Filtration Systems With Recirculation Of Retentate

A method of filtering a liquid feed is described, comprising passing a liquid feed through a single pass tangential flow filtration (SPTFF) system and recovering the retentate and permeate from the system in separate containers. A method of filtering a liquid feed is also described comprising passing a liquid feed through a tangential flow filtration (TFF) system, recovering permeate and a portion of the retentate from the system in separate containers without recirculation through the TFF system, and recirculating the remainder of the retentate through the TFF system at least once. The methods of the invention can be performed using an SPTFF or a TFF system that comprises manifold segments to serialize the flow path of the feed and retentate without requiring diverter plates.

Separation systems for removing starch and other usable by-products from processing waste water

The present invention provides for a method for separating starch from processing solutions containing starch containing plants or roots such as potatoes, sweet potatoes, wheat, corn, tapioca, yams, cassaya, sago, rice, pea, broad bean, horse bean, sorghum, konjac, rye, buckwheat and barley to provide commercially acceptable starch while reducing disposal of solid or liquid waste matter into landfills or water treatment facilities.

Multipurpose Membrane Cell Stack and Method of Manufacturing the Same

Membrane cell stack arrangement comprising a housing, a stack of membranes defining flow compartments and a fluid manifold system, wherein the direction of flow through the flow compartments is different to the direction of flow through entry and exit openings and the width of the entry and exit openings are each larger than 45% of the width of the flow compartment.

CARTRIDGE CLAMPING DEVICE
20180361322 · 2018-12-20 ·

A clamping device (1) is provided for cartridge filtration modules (2) that have a distribution plate (3) with a feed channel (18), a retentate channel (21), a filtrate channel, and a first contact surface (8). At least one filter cartridge can be clamped between a contact surface (8) of the distribution plate (3) and a clamping surface (29) of a clamping plate (4) that can be moved orthogonally to the contact surface (8). The cartridge filtration modules (2) can be stacked on one another in an area of their distribution plates (3). A common distribution plate (3) for adjacent filter cartridge arrangements can clamped against the contact surface (8). Adjacent filter cartridge arrangements can be connected in a parallel circuit via the distribution plate (3), and the cartridge filtration modules (2) that can be stacked on top of one another can be connected in series via the distribution plates (3).

Device for processing water, system, and methods
12064729 · 2024-08-20 · ·

Apparatus and methods for use in water processing include housing sections that house in their interiors water treating membranes, the respective interiors being separate from one another. A distributor chamber for containing a flow of water to be treated conveys water to be treated from a feed inlet and distributes the water to be treated into the interiors of the housing sections. A collector chamber for collecting treated water from the interiors of the housing sections is provided to communicate a merged flow of the treated water to an extraction outlet. The device may be employed in subsea systems or in a topside water processing system.
